It is most famous for it’s manipulation of time. Though the events in the book only take seconds, the story is over eight pages long. Time seems to slow for the man in the noose and at the same time speed up for the reader. As Crook stated that individual makes two attributions. First, the intimate attribution, where suppose an individual due to something about that person acts in a certain manner such as bearing or temperament. Secondly an outer attribution, presumption that people are acting in a given manner because of something about the situation they are in. Extent and Utilization Theory on attribution has been applied in demonstrating the variance in motivation between high and low achievers particularly in workplace setting like in the shop setting explained here(Harvey and Madison 2014). As per the theory, high achievers will approach tasks related to succeeding instead of avoiding them, because they base their trust in the fact that achievement relates to trust on high effort as displayed by the salesperson that could not let go the customer (Graham and Taylor, 2016). Failure is considered to be affected by a poor exam and is not their responsibility. As such, omission is negligible concerning morale, though achievement develops self regard and determination. Contrary to that, underachievers dodge tasks that are success oriented since they incline to assume achievement is connected to external elements. For this reason, it isn't taken as prosperity by dismal achievers after winning for lack of responsibility thus belief remains the same (Lyndon and Mc Cammon, 2016).
